Vice Chancellor's International Excellence Scholarship: University of Waikato, New Zealand


Value:

  • Up to NZD $15,000 towards tuition fees for undergraduate students.
  • Up to NZD $10,000 towards tuition fees for postgraduate (taught) students.​


Eligible Areas of Study:

The scholarship is available for all subject areas offered at the University, including:​

Arts

  • Business & Management
  • Computer Science
  • Mathematics
  • Education
  • Health
  • Engineering
  • Law
  • Māori & Indigenous Studies
  • Science
  • Social Sciences​

Eligibility Requirements:

Applicants must:

  • Be new international students applying to enroll full-time in undergraduate or postgraduate (taught) programs at the University of Waikato.
  • Have received a conditional or unconditional offer of place from the University.
  • Have achieved a minimum GPA equivalent to a B+ in previous studies.
  • Not be currently enrolled at the University of Waikato.
  • Not be coming through a sponsoring body, a Guaranteed Credit Arrangement, or as part of a study abroad or exchange program.
  • Not have paid tuition fees or applied for a visa at the time of application.​

Application Process:

Apply for Admission:

  • Submit an application to enroll at the University of Waikato.
  • Obtain a conditional or unconditional offer of place.​

Apply for the Scholarship:

  • Log in to the MyWaikato portal.
  • Navigate to the 'Scholarships' tab.

Complete the scholarship application form, including:

  • Uploading your offer of place.
  • Providing a personal statement (maximum 200 words) outlining:
  • Your career goals and aspirations.
  • How an international education experience will help you achieve these goals.
  • What qualities or skills make you an ideal candidate and potential ambassador for the University.


Application Deadlines:

Applications are reviewed monthly, excluding December. To be considered for a specific intake, applications must be received by:​

  • 30 November for A Trimester offers of place.
  • 30 April for B Trimester offers of place.
  • 31 August for C Trimester offers of place.
  • 31 October for H or X Trimester offers of place.
